Transaction 703a3305161a6b29155b1a5cb63d5fca9c56c80fdb29f141338beae1b02168e6

1 Input
2 Outputs
  • 703a3305161a6b29155b1a5cb63d5fca9c56c80fdb29f141338beae1b02168e6:0
  • value  18331969140
    address  39rswWPMDZFKjriNQry99FEyaYY81e5rgn
  • 703a3305161a6b29155b1a5cb63d5fca9c56c80fdb29f141338beae1b02168e6:1
  • value  510726
    address  33ypjzs7XkrFcPiTbjctFW55EUN372KoiJ